Cash flows, capital returns, and balance sheet
Apple also continues to generate substantial operating cash flow each quarter, enabling it to fund both internal investment and ongoing capital return to shareholders. In fiscal 2025 materials available on Apple’s financial statements, management outlined significant cash flow from operations and free cash flow, supporting a large ongoing share repurchase program and regular dividends.
The company’s balance sheet shows large holdings of cash, cash equivalents, and marketable securities, offset by long-term debt used to optimize capital structure and fund buybacks. According to Apple’s long-term capital allocation commentary published with its fiscal 2025 results on its investor relations site, management aims to reach a net cash neutral position over time, balancing cash balances and debt against future capital returns.

iPhone and services business lines
Apple’s iPhone remains central to the company’s ecosystem strategy, with each new generation of the device designed to bring users deeper into its hardware and services universe. Recent product cycles have emphasized camera quality, processor performance, and integration with services, as described in product launch materials and keynote summaries accessible via Apple’s corporate pages linked from its investor relations portal.
The services segment includes offerings such as digital content subscriptions and cloud storage, which typically carry higher gross margins than hardware. As Apple highlighted in recent investor updates on its investor relations site, the installed base of active devices has reached hundreds of millions worldwide, creating a large addressable audience for services and expanding recurring revenue potential.

Apple stock facts
- Company: Apple Inc.
- ISIN: US0378331005
- Ticker: NASDAQ: AAPL
- Trading venue: Nasdaq
- Sector / Industry: Information Technology / Consumer Electronics
- Index membership: S&P 500, Nasdaq 100, Dow Jones Industrial Average
